The Falcons did plenty in Sunday’s loss to the Colts to give themselves a chance. They recorded seven sacks, forced two turnovers, and even took the lead with under two minutes remaining. But in the end, they couldn’t make the plays that mattered most. A major reason: they went 0-for-8 on third down. And while Michael Penix is still growing and developing at the NFL level, the Falcons don’t have the margin for error to wait for that progress to pay off.
